Top 5 Investing and Financial Management Apps in the US - Q4 2025
Explore the performance of the leading investing and financial management apps in the US during Q4 2025 on a unified platform.
The fourth quarter of 2025 saw interesting trends among the top investing and financial management applications in the United States, based on data from Sensor Tower. Here's a closer look at the performance of these leading apps.
Fidelity Investments experienced a relatively stable period in terms of weekly downloads, starting at approximately 123K and peaking at 154K by the end of the quarter. The weekly active users fluctuated, with a notable increase in the last week, reaching around 7.8M.
Robinhood: Trading & Investing saw its weekly downloads begin at 139K, with a mid-quarter dip, and then recovering to 122K by the end of December. The app maintained a strong user base, with active users peaking at 14.5M mid-quarter and ending at 13.5M.
Coinbase: Buy BTC, ETH, SOL had a modest start with 105K downloads, which gradually declined to 72K by the end of the quarter. Active users saw some fluctuations, starting at 7.7M and finishing the quarter with a slight increase to 6.4M.
Kraken: Buy Crypto & Stocks reported revenue growth, peaking at about $39.6K in mid-November. Downloads started at 107K, with a significant drop to 44K by year-end. Active users showed a slight decline, from 494K to 508K.
Lastly, Crypto.com: Buy BTC, ETH & CRO began with 56K downloads, dipping to 37K mid-quarter, and recovering to 47K in December. Active users saw a notable decrease from 2.4M to approximately 1.5M by the end of the quarter.
